Before, the floor was sand from the beach and the house was ground level, making potential floods. Now there is enough cement for it to be raised and it is smooth and clean. (Now when we visit, Elijah does not have to eat the sand from the floor).

Before, there was a sheet for a curtain separating that corner for a room. Now there are walls for a closed-in room (no bed yet, but maybe someday, and no lights or fan yet, but praying God will soon provide).
Here we are in the doorway! Before there was no door (unsafe, scary...), now there is a door. Note also the steps going up now so that there are no floods or mud.

Also, there was cement available to smooth the interior walls, wood for a ceiling and support for the roof. Before there was a whimpy pole in the middle consisiting of two broken pieces of wood hammered together. Now it seems like a whole new house! Praise God! There's always more to gain visions for, like this "shower". This is up a hill nearby the house where they hose down behind a curtain outdoors. They have to shower with their clothes on because people can stand on the hill and look in to see. Soon there will be a C.R. (comfort room), Aka, an outhouse, but right now, where do they use the C.R.? Their house is too low to make a proper hole in the ground so they have to build one up the hill.
Outside the front door they share this cooking area. They make a fire with charcoal and cook the rice in the pot.
